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Black-headed Heron | Robust Golden Mole |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Pelecaniformes (Pelecaniformes) | Afrosoricida (Afrosoricida) |
| Family | Ardeidae | Chrysochloridae |
| Genus | Ardea | Amblysomus |
| Species | Ardea melanocephala | Amblysomus robustus |
Evolutionary Relationship
Black-headed Heron and Robust Golden Mole share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
